News summary

The Baltimore Ravens are facing a challenging start to the season with an 0-2 record, a first since 2015, prompting concerns about their offensive line's performance. Head coach John Harbaugh has openly criticized right guard Daniel Faalele's struggles, while backup Ben Cleveland asserts his readiness to step up. Despite the offensive line issues, Harbaugh remains optimistic, emphasizing the season's long-term improvement potential. Quarterback Lamar Jackson, who has shown strong individual performances, vows to lead the team back on track. The Ravens will seek their first win against the Dallas Cowboys in Week 3. Meanwhile, Joe Burrow of the Cincinnati Bengals is also dealing with an 0-2 start but remains confident in his team's ability to bounce back.
